Routes 67 and 149 bus proposal by TfL Have Your Say

Transport for London (TFL) recently published a major proposal on a new set of bus changes on routes 67 and 149, we need your help to save our buses! They have proposed to permanently withdraw the 149s section to Edmonton Green.

Route 149 is one of London's busiest bus routes carrying approximately 12 million passengers annually, it is also the only bus route in the Enfield borough that takes you the furthest into central London from Edmonton Green to London Bridge.  Losing this vital link to Edmonton green will mean passengers will have to forcefully change on multiple buses to complete their journey considering 349 is getting withdrawn soon, this means routes 259 and 279 will be the only routes travelling through the A1010 corridor if the changes were to proceed.

Most residents in Enfield use Buses as their main mode of transport due to the lack of London Underground and half of Enfield's bus routes have already suffered frequency reductions.  A bus withdrawal in Enfield heavily impacts other services making travelling insufferable during peak hour times. TFL's consultation is live until 20th September. It proposes the following changes:

  • Route 67 from Wood Green to Dalston Junction would be withdrawn.
  • Route 149 would be rerouted to run from Wood Green to London Bridge replacing route 67 entirely at a reduced weekday frequency.
